Not all dogs are this lucky. Texas, and much of the south, is a pretty rough place for dogs. Shelters are over-run with strays, owner surrenders and breeder cast-offs , and many of these dogs are euthanized simply for lack of space. It's a heartbreaking situation and unfortunately many people are unaware of just how bad things are.


Every day I post the euthanasia list as a Hail Mary that someone will see them and adopt or foster. It also serves as a way to educate the public that there is a crisis going on, dogs are losing their lives, and we as a community need to take action. In Texas alone, 82,000 dogs and cats were euthanized in shelters in 2023. We can help. Support rescues. Adopt or foster. Tell friends and family what is happening. Spay and neuter pets.
